Methods and systems to browse data items
First Claim
Patent Images
1. A system comprising:
- one or more processors; and
a computer-readable medium storing instructions that, when used by the one or more processors, cause the one or more processors to at least;
determine a level of interest of a user for a first browsing set from a plurality of browsing sets, each browsing set comprising a corresponding browsing concept and a plurality of corresponding browsing values that are user-selectable to identify data items having selected browsing values, the level of interest of the user for the first browsing set based on selections of one or more browsing values from a plurality of browsing values for a first browsing concept of the first browsing set made by the user in previous search sessions;
receive, from a client machine, a query including at least one keyword;
automatically select, the first browsing set based on the query and the level of interest of the user for the first browsing set;
generate a user interface including the first browsing set and a set of search results; and
communicate, to the client machine, the user interface including the first browsing set and the set of search results, the user interface identifying the first browsing concept and providing at least a portion of the plurality of browsing values for the first browsing set for selection by the user to refine the set of search results.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ods and Systems to browse data items. There is provided a method and system to enable a buyer to browse listings that are listed, by sellers on a network-based marketplace and stored in a data resource. There is further provided a method to cancel characteristics used to identify listings that are listed by sellers on a network-based marketplace.
302 Citations
20 Claims
-
1. A system comprising:
-
one or more processors; and a computer-readable medium storing instructions that, when used by the one or more processors, cause the one or more processors to at least; determine a level of interest of a user for a first browsing set from a plurality of browsing sets, each browsing set comprising a corresponding browsing concept and a plurality of corresponding browsing values that are user-selectable to identify data items having selected browsing values, the level of interest of the user for the first browsing set based on selections of one or more browsing values from a plurality of browsing values for a first browsing concept of the first browsing set made by the user in previous search sessions; receive, from a client machine, a query including at least one keyword; automatically select, the first browsing set based on the query and the level of interest of the user for the first browsing set; generate a user interface including the first browsing set and a set of search results; and communicate, to the client machine, the user interface including the first browsing set and the set of search results, the user interface identifying the first browsing concept and providing at least a portion of the plurality of browsing values for the first browsing set for selection by the user to refine the set of search results. - View Dependent Claims (4, 5, 6, 7, 8, 9)
-
-
2. A method comprising:
-
determining a level of interest of a user for a first browsing set from a plurality of browsing sets, each browsing set comprising a corresponding browsing concept and a plurality of corresponding browsing values that are user-selectable to identify data items having selected browsing values, the level of interest of the user for the first browsing set based on selections of one or more browsing values from a plurality of browsing values for a first browsing concept of the first browsing set made by the user in previous search sessions; receiving from a client machine, a query including at least one keyword, automatically selecting the first browsing set based on the query and the level of interest of the user for the first browsing set; generating user interface including the first browsing set and a set of search results; and communicating, to the client machine, the user interface including the first browsing set and the set of search results, the user interface identifying the first browsing concept and providing at least a portion of the plurality of browsing values for the first browsing set for selection by the user to refine the set of search results. - View Dependent Claims (10, 11, 12, 13, 14, 15)
-
-
3. A non-transitory machine readable medium storing a set of instructions that, when used by a machine, cause the machine to:
-
determine a level of interest of a user for a first browsing set from a plurality of browsing sets, each browsing set comprising a corresponding browsing concept and a plurality of corresponding browsing values that are user-selectable to identify data items having selected browsing values, the level of interest of the user for the first browsing set based on selections of one or more browsing values from a plurality of browsing values for a first browsing concept of the first browsing set made by the user in previous search sessions; receive, from a client machine, a query including at least one keyword; automatically select the first browsing based on the query and the level of interest of the user for the first browsing set; generate a user interface including the first browsing set and a set of search results; and communicate, to the client machine, the user interface including the first browsing set and the set of search results, the user interface identifying the first browsing concept and providing at least a portion of the plurality of browsing values for the first browsing set for selection by the user to refine the set of search results.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ification